Description

Allyltrimethylgermane is a high-purity organogermanium compound featuring an allyl functional group. This compound is valued for its role as a versatile building block in advanced materials science and organic synthesis, particularly for introducing germanium-containing moieties. It is primarily utilized by researchers and manufacturers in the semiconductor, polymer, and specialty chemical industries for developing novel precursors and functional materials.

Application

  • Semiconductor Precursor: Used in chemical vapor deposition (CVD) and atomic layer deposition (ALD) processes for depositing germanium-containing thin films.
  • Organic Synthesis Intermediate: Serves as a key reagent in cross-coupling reactions and for the synthesis of novel organogermanium compounds.
  • Polymer Modification: Acts as a functional monomer or cross-linking agent to incorporate germanium into polymer backbones, altering material properties.
  • Catalysis Research: Investigated as a ligand or precursor in the development of novel homogeneous and heterogeneous catalysts.
  • Material Science R&D: Employed in the research and development of advanced electronic, optical, and photovoltaic materials.
  • Pharmaceutical Intermediates: Used in exploratory synthesis for creating novel bioactive molecules containing germanium.

Basic Information

Product Name Allyltrimethylgermane
CAS No. 762-66-3
Molecular Formula C6H14Ge
Molecular Weight 158.77 g/mol
Synonyms Trimethyl(2-propenyl)germane; (Allyl)trimethylgermane; Allyltrimethylgermanium; 3-Trimethylgermylpropene; 2-Propen-1-yltrimethylgermane; Germanium, trimethyl-2-propenyl-; Allyltrimethylstannane analog (germanium)

Storage

Preserve in a tightly closed container, protected from light. Store under an inert atmosphere (e.g., nitrogen or argon) in a cool, dry, and well-ventilated area. Recommended storage temperature is 2-8°C to maximize stability. Keep away from heat, sparks, and open flames.
